Virgil van Dijk lifted the Premier League title on Sunday, with Liverpool being presented with the trophy following their 1-1 draw with FA Cup winners Crystal Palace at Anfield.
Liverpool finished the 2024-25 campaign with just two points from four matches, with the Merseyside giants certainly reducing their performance level after managing to secure the title at the end of April.
Arne Slot's side ended the season with a record of 25 wins, nine draws and four defeats from 38 matches, with 84 points leaving them 10 points ahead of second-placed Arsenal in the Premier League table.
Van Dijk was once again a key contributor for Liverpool, with the Netherlands international showing his class throughout the campaign, and he lifted the Premier League trophy above his head at Anfield on Sunday afternoon.
